Is Virginia Tech a good vet school?
120 students per year are accepted into the four year DVM program. Virginia Tech Vet School was ranked #17 by US News and World Reports in 2011. Virginia Tech Vet School was found by the Virginia General Assembly in 1978.

How much does it cost to go to Cornell vet school?
Cost of Attendance
| New York State Resident | Non-New York State Resident | |
|---|---|---|
| Tuition | $39,206 | $58,244 |
| Mandatory Fees | $506 | $506 |
| Room and Board | $10,500 | $10,500 |
| Books and Supplies | $1,000 | $1,000 |

Does UMD have a vet school?
The University of Maryland has partnered with Virginia Tech to form the Virginia-Maryland Regional College of Veterinary Medicine. This college offers a four-year full-time program leading to the Doctor of Veterinary Medicine (DVM) degree.
How hard is it to become a vet?
Training to become a veterinarian takes almost as much time as becoming a human doctor, and it’s just as involved. You typically do four years of undergraduate and have to complete the prerequisites and required tests to get into veterinary school, which is another four years of school.
